Choosing Your Poolside Glass: A Material Guide
- Tritan Plastic: The gold standard for durability and long-term clarity; it resists scratches and clouding significantly better than standard acrylic.
- Stainless Steel: Unbeatable for temperature retention, though it lacks the visual appeal of seeing the color of the wine.
- Polycarbonate/Polymer: A lightweight, highly flexible option that is virtually impossible to shatter, making it the safest choice for busy, high-traffic pool decks.
- Cooling Gel Infused: These offer advanced thermal performance but require freezer space and handling care to ensure the interior gel layer isn’t compromised.
Always check that materials are BPA-free, as prolonged exposure to heat and UV light can degrade lower-quality plastics. Prioritize dishwasher-safe materials to ensure that sanitization is quick and effective after every use. A clear distinction should be made between “shatterproof” materials, which are impact-resistant, and “scratch-resistant” materials, which help maintain aesthetic clarity.
How to Keep Your Plastic Glasses Crystal Clear
- Avoid Abrasives: Always use a soft sponge or microfiber cloth; harsh scrubbers create micro-scratches that lead to a foggy appearance.
- Dishwasher Placement: Stick to the top rack away from the heating element, as high heat can cause warping or clouding in some polymers.
- Hand Wash Frequency: When possible, hand washing prevents the buildup of mineral deposits that often appear as stubborn, cloudy spots over time.
- Vinegar Soak: If a glass begins to look hazy, a quick soak in a mixture of warm water and white vinegar can dissolve mineral buildup and restore shine.
Stemmed vs. Stemless: What’s Best for the Deck?
Stemless glasses are generally superior for poolside environments because they have a lower center of gravity, making them significantly less prone to tipping over. On uneven stone decks or crowded side tables, a stemless base provides much-needed stability. They are also easier to store in tight cabinets or cooler bags during transport.
Stemmed plastic glasses, however, offer a more elegant presentation for formal outdoor dinners. If the pool deck setup includes stable, flat-surfaced tables and a more formal dining atmosphere, the traditional stem shape remains appropriate. Ultimately, match the shape to the stability of the furniture available to minimize the chance of spills.
Poolside Drinking Safety: Beyond the Glassware
While selecting the right glass is a massive step forward, total pool safety involves broader habits. Always keep a dedicated area for drinks away from the immediate edge of the pool to prevent accidental knock-overs into the water. If a beverage does spill, address the puddle immediately to prevent slips on wet deck surfaces.
Encourage the use of beverage coasters or tray surfaces to keep glasses elevated and stable. Remember that glass is not just a hazard when broken; condensation can make any glass slippery, so choosing designs with textured grips or wider bases is a smart preventative measure.
